Stain removal basics
What makes some stains so difficult to remove is ingraining. Here are the fundamentals to avoid it.
Act as quickly as possible
Never wash a fabric that is already stained
Never use hot water
To preserve fabrics and colors, it is important to always test the product on a small, inconspicuous area before using it on the stained area.
